Dual-Polarized SAR and Stokes Parameters
IEEE Geoscience and Remote Sensing Letters, 2006For a given transmission polarization, the four-element Stokes vector captures all of the information inherent to the dual-polarized backscattered signals. Stokes parameters are linear combinations of the like-polarized power, the cross-polarized power, and the cross product between the complex image amplitudes in the two receive channels.
